The squat pattern is functional, and the mini band will encourage the client to maintain proper knee ... green frog rabbit hutchWebNov 22, 2024 · Ankle Wall Stretch. Begin with your foot several inches away from a wall. Lean in towards the wall and bend your knee until it is touching the wall. Hold for 30~ seconds.
